logo

Output 72fee84b32038e62a18771b345eead5a7d561b60da179dedd44a099eafd36292:65

value
9966069
script pubkey
OP_0 OP_PUSHBYTES_20 37131f87853c2e0a54402639bd0b05ca2b29716b
address
bc1qxuf3lpu98shq54zqycum6zc9eg4jjutt6ek954
transaction
72fee84b32038e62a18771b345eead5a7d561b60da179dedd44a099eafd36292